Carl Ellison Cornwall was born May 25, 1942, in Wenatchee, Washington, to Francis and Doris Cornwall. He passed away on September 16, 2025, in Boise, Idaho, with family present.

Carl grew up in the agricultural communities of Yakima Valley, WA. He attended Moxee schools, graduating in 1960 with classmates who are still close friends.

In 1961, Carl joined his family on the Royal Slope. There, neighbor Doug Snodgrass tried to introduce his sister, Carol, to our hero. After several failed attempts, Carl did the deed himself, saving his damsel in distress from an uncooperative siphon tube. Romance blossomed, and Carl married Carol Snodgrass on October 20, 1962. They were sealed in the Idaho Falls Temple a year later. They attended Central Washington State College where Carl graduated with a degree in Health and Phys.Ed.

The ensuing years were filled with more school for the couple and the building of a family as they welcomed their children, Keli, Kevin, and Craig. After teaching and coaching for 10 years, Carl left his career in education and embarked on a number of endeavors including mining and trucking, always keeping space for another lifelong love, farming and ranching.

Carl’s faith was extremely important to him, and he served in various positions in the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. His favorite areas of service were Boy Scout leadership and temple service.

In 2011, after years of good health, Carl was diagnosed with cancer. Carol supported him through 2 years of treatment, including a stem cell transplant. The family was thrilled to have had 12 more years with him after that close call.

Carl is survived by his wife, Carol, daughter Keli (Cleeo), and sons Kevin (Heather) and Craig (Morgan), along with 18 grandchildren and 16 great-grandchildren and counting. He was preceded in death by his parents, Francis and Doris, and his sister, Jody Urdahl.

Funeral services will be held at 11:00 a.m., Tuesday, September 23, 2025, at the Northview Chapel of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, 6711 Northview St., Boise, ID.
